Stay updated with the latest trends and news across various industries.
Discover why your website appears differently across devices and learn the simple fixes to achieve a consistent look everywhere!
Understanding website rendering is crucial for web developers and designers, as it explains why a site may look different across various browsers. Each browser uses its own rendering engine, which interprets HTML, CSS, and JavaScript code in slightly different ways. For instance, while Chrome uses the Blink engine, Firefox operates on Gecko. These differences can lead to variations in layout, fonts, and overall design, making it essential for developers to test their websites across multiple platforms to ensure consistency and a seamless user experience.
Furthermore, browser compatibility issues can arise due to discrepancies in how each rendering engine handles specific coding techniques or styles. It is not uncommon for features like CSS Grid or Flexbox to behave differently in older browsers that do not fully support these technologies. To mitigate these challenges, developers often implement fallbacks, polyfills, or use CSS resets to standardize styles. Understanding these complexities helps in creating websites that not only look great but also perform well across varying environments.
When it comes to web design, responsive design is key to ensuring that your website appears consistently across all devices. However, many websites still suffer from discrepancies between the mobile and desktop versions due to various factors. One common cause is the use of different CSS stylesheets for mobile and desktop versions. This means that specific elements may be displayed differently based on the device being used. Additionally, oversized images or non-optimized media can cause layout issues on mobile, resulting in a less user-friendly experience.
Another reason for a varied appearance is the presence of incompatible plugins or scripts that may not function well on mobile browsers. These elements might cause content to shift or not load correctly, further contributing to the inconsistency. Also, website loading times can be affected by the lack of optimization for mobile browsing, which can lead to inconsistent user experiences. To avoid these issues, it's important to regularly test your site on multiple devices and use tools designed to improve mobile responsiveness.
Achieving consistent website design across all devices and platforms is essential for enhancing user experience and improving SEO performance. Start by implementing a responsive web design (RWD) approach, which allows your website to adapt seamlessly to various screen sizes. This can be accomplished by using flexible grids and layouts, ensuring that images resize appropriately, and utilizing media queries to tailor styles for different devices. Additionally, prioritizing mobile-first design not only helps in creating a uniform look but also addresses the increasing number of mobile users, thus boosting your site's accessibility.
Another critical step is to maintain a cohesive style guide that outlines the use of fonts, colors, and overall branding elements across your website. By establishing a clear set of design standards, you ensure that all pages and components are visually aligned, regardless of the device or platform. Moreover, testing your design on various browsers and devices is vital to identify any inconsistencies. Leverage tools like browser developer tools and online testing platforms to run thorough checks. By following these best practices, you will enhance not only the aesthetics but also the functionality of your site, providing a consistent user experience that fosters engagement and retention.